Rain is expected in western and northern regions of Ukraine on April 16
On Thursday, April 16, a high-pressure system will dominate the weather in most regions, though western and northern areas will be affected by an atmospheric front. This will result in light rain in those parts of the country, while no precipitation is expected elsewhere.
This is reported by the Ukrainian Hydrometeorological Center.

Nighttime temperatures will range from 3 to 8°C. During the day, temperatures will rise to 14–19°C, ensuring relatively warm weather despite cloud cover. Winds will be predominantly from the southwest at 5–10 m/s.
In Kyiv and the surrounding region, variable cloudiness is forecast for tomorrow, with a chance of light rain during the day. In the capital, nighttime temperatures will range from 6–8°C, and during the day, temperatures will rise to 16–18°C.
